Handover Note — Billing Transition

Welcome aboard. The move to annual billing for Quillward's Fenrow suite is mid-flight: 40% of accounts converted, renewals team trained, and the discount ladder approved at 12% for prepay. Watch churn in the Ostbridge region, where monthly billing was a selling point. Legal has cleared the revised terms. The underlying rationale, which you should hold closely, is set out below.

board note of fahif-yahog: Gross margin on Wenath came in at 10 percent against a plan of 5 percent. Only 3 of the 100 pilot accounts renewed Wenath, so a churn review is set for July 15.

Subject: Pool car keys — where to find them

Hi all! Quick note for new starters at Fennwick Grove: the pool car keys live in the grey cabinet behind reception, next to the umbrella stand. Sign the logbook every time you take a set — no exceptions, sorry! The cabinet stays locked, so you'll need the code below.

turnstile pass: bdg-NG-3

Action item from the Tollgate payments postmortem: the integration tests flake because they share one sandbox ledger, so parallel runs trip over each other. Fix is per-run ledger namespacing — Dana's got a draft. Until that lands, retry once before paging anyone. We wrote up the flaky-test triage steps and quarantine list here.

wiki page, tahaf-tajog: https://jira.ordindyn.corp/pipeline